Cafe Max - Edina

#3 - Seafood - Edina, #8 - Pizza - Edina, Cafés
6700 France Ave S, Edina, 55435-1902, United States Of America
Dishes: 6

Cafe Max

Phone
+19529291072
Address
6700 France Ave S, Edina, 55435-1902, United States Of America

Amenities

Menu
Outdoor
Street Parking
Outdoor Dining

Menu Items

More information

Related Restaurants

Fast & SimpleDownload Menulist App now